What is the Multi Family Property Listing Form?

The Multi Family Property Listing Form is an essential tool in Wisconsin's real estate market, serving as a critical resource for real estate agents and brokers. This form is designed to gather detailed information about multi-family properties, facilitating a smoother transaction process. Information captured includes the number of units, annual income, expenses, and various property features.
Understanding this form is vital as it aids agents in effectively marketing properties to potential buyers by presenting comprehensive data. The Multi Family Property Listing Form not only enhances visibility but also supports informed decision-making throughout the buying process.

Key Features of the Multi Family Property Listing Form

The Multi Family Property Listing Form is equipped with several key features designed for efficient data entry and clarity. It contains multiple labeled input fields to ensure stakeholders can provide detailed property data appropriately.
  • Sections dedicated to unit-specific features, such as the number of bedrooms and bathrooms.
  • Check boxes for status updates, allowing users to easily indicate if a property is active, sold, or withheld.
These features help ensure that all relevant information is captured comprehensively, facilitating a smoother review and transaction process.
